Headers with EGR

Hey guys I have an 87’ 2.8L and it has egr and I’m wondering if I have to “put it in the header” or delete it somehow? Wouldn’t it have to be removed from the computer? Idek

Re: Headers with EGR

To be clear, you're changing the exhaust manifolds to headers? In that case, you need to either plumb the egr to the headers in a similar fashion as the manifolds, or delete the egr by blocking off the intake port from the egr and have a chip burned for the egr delete.
